


Snyk and SentinelOne Singularity Cloud Security compete in the cloud security domain. Snyk appears to have the upper hand in terms of ease of integration and developer-friendliness, while SentinelOne excels in advanced threat detection and response.
Features: Snyk is notable for its simplicity, ease of integration into developer environments, and extensive vulnerability database. Users value its Slack integration for real-time notifications. SentinelOne offers advanced threat detection and response capabilities with an AI-driven engine, providing comprehensive real-time security insights. Its ongoing integration with third-party tools adds functionality to its robust feature set.
Room for Improvement: Snyk could expand its security scanning capabilities with features like SAST and DAST. Users recommend improvements in library usage visibility, managing vulnerabilities, language support, and user interface. SentinelOne could improve by reducing resource consumption, enhancing documentation, and expanding support for integrations, particularly in Kubernetes.
Ease of Deployment and Customer Service: Snyk offers versatile deployment options for cloud and on-premises environments, with a focus on self-service for developers and responsive customer support. SentinelOne is primarily cloud-focused, known for its intuitive deployment process but facing occasional integration challenges. Users appreciate its support but see room for improvement in complex deployment phases.
Pricing and ROI: Snyk’s pricing is considered high but justified by its comprehensive features, offering positive ROI with increased developer productivity. SentinelOne is competitively priced for its market, providing robust features despite high initial costs. It is often cited for a better ROI when consolidating multiple security solutions into its comprehensive platform.

Qualys TotalCloud enhances security posture across cloud environments with continuous monitoring, vulnerability management, and risk visualization, ensuring efficient threat assessment and automated remediation for improved cyber risk reduction.
Qualys TotalCloud offers a robust suite of security tools essential for organizations managing multi-cloud infrastructures. By integrating cloud accounts and automating workflows, it supports AWS, Azure, and GCP, offering comprehensive vulnerability management and zero-day detection. The platform's user-friendly design, combined with its extensive risk management and unified threat assessment capabilities, enables organizations to prioritize and remediate vulnerabilities effectively. TruRisk Insights provides clear insights on cyber risks, while the automation options streamline patch management and scanning processes. API integration across IaaS and SaaS environments further enhances resource allocation efficiency and saves time, addressing misconfigurations across cloud environments.

Industries leverage Snyk for security in CI/CD pipelines by automating checks for dependency vulnerabilities and managing open-source licenses. Its Docker and Kubernetes scanning capabilities enhance container security, supporting a proactive security approach. Integrations with platforms like GitHub and Azure DevOps optimize implementation across diverse software environments.
